"With a whip-like movement, Crabbe pointed his wand at the fifty-foot mountain of old furniture, of broken trunks, of old books and robes and unidentifiable junk and shouted, "Descendo!" The wall began to totter, then crumbled into the aisle next door where Ron stood."
— Crabbe tries to kill Ron with this spell.[src]

Descendo is a spell that likely causes any targeted object to move downwards.

Etymology

Descendo is Latin for "I descend".
